Nigerian Army Opens Portal for 2020 DSSC and SSC Recruitment



The Nigerian Army has through their Twitter handle announced that it has opened portal for the Short Service Combatant Course (SSC) 47/2021 and Direct Short Service Commission Course (DSSC) 26/2021 recruitment.

According to a post on the recruitment portal, the Nigerian Army demands that applicants must meet the following requirements:
  • Applicants must be a Nigerian citizen by birth and have a national identity card.
  • Possess at least 4 credits in no more than 2 sessions in WASSCE / GCE / NECO / NABTEB. One of the credits must be in English.
  • In addition to the above qualifications, merchants/women applicants must also have an OND / Craft Exam / City and Syndicate Certificate.
  • Be between 18 and 22 years for non-craftsmen / women while merchants/women must be between 18 and 26 years old by March 1, 2019.
  • Be not less than 1.68 m in height and 1.62 m in length for the male and females respectively.
  • Bachelor’s or master’s degree in another relevant discipline in the quantitative field or a higher national diploma in a related discipline in the quantitative field.
  • Computer literacy and familiarity with Microsoft Office and web applications and the use of related applications to provide the service efficiently.
  • Knowledge of an additional Nigerian language other than the mother tongue is an advantage.

How to Apply for Nigerian Army Recruitment 2020

Interested Nigerians are urged to visit the Nigerian Army recruitment portal https://recruitment.army.mil.ng/  to fill and submit the application form.

 Required Documents for Nigerian Army Recruitment

According to the Nigerian Army, applicants should ensure they upload the following documents while filling their forms:
  • Passport photograph.
  • Educational certificates.
  • Evidence of membership of any professional body.
  • Certificate of state of origin.
  • Birth certificate or age declaration.

For DSSC applicants, note that the qualification selections available to you are dependent on the preferred corps selected.

 Recruitment Deadline

The recruitment process starts on Wednesday, August 19th, 2020 and ends on September 29th, 2020.
